SD Counties Have to Wait for Additional Dollars

South Dakota Governor Dennis Daugaard has told county commissions to “be patient” as money from taxes and fees that were raised last year flow to local governments. Many counties are feeling the pinch between road repairs and law enforcement costs.
Representative Mike Stevens of Yankton says counties still have some local taxing options…..

Stevens says there is only one bill so far that has any money for counties this year…..

Stevens says counties may have to wait and see the outcome of the education and Medicaid initiatives to see if there are any other funding options.
